Determine whether you’d like an aerosol oil sprayer or a non-aerosol sprayer. Some aerosol sprayers use chemical propellants. Non-aerosol sprayers have an internal pump that you must manually prep before the oil will come out. For example, you’ll need to pump the cap of some sprayers between 10 and 15 times before pressing the nozzle to coat your pan with oil. Simplemost Media If the head clogs, you’ll need to empty the oil sprayer and fill it with hot water. Afterward, press the nozzle to run the hot water through the system. The hot water will dislodge the oil so that you can resume using the sprayer to flavor your meals. Generally, oil sprayers come in three different materials: glass, stainless steel, and plastic. The most common type of container is glass since it's naturally chemical-free, doesn’t absorb smells or flavors, and has an elegant aesthetic. Stainless steel is also a popular choice because it’s extremely durable, plus has a protected interior that makes the oil less susceptible to degradation. Plastic is also a nice option for busy kitchens because it's lightweight, durable, and easy to clean. It’s also budget-friendly. Unfortunately, though, plastic can retain odors and flavors over time.

If you use a lot of cooking oil, consider a larger vessel. If, on the other hand, you reach for the oil only every so often, choose a smaller sprayer.
